This Second Growth estate has been owned by the Borie family for more than 60 years. Now managed by Bruno Borie and his sister Sabine Coiffe, Ducru is now producing quintessential St Julien, powerful and balanced, with a distinctive sleek character.

What the critics say

Robert Parker (RP) — 96/100 · Wine Advocate, RobertParker.com, 30/04/2006 · Drink 2010-2025

One of the most compelling Ducru Beaucaillou's made in the last quarter century is the 2003 (which is also the first vintage to be packaged in an impressive heavy glass bottle with a special long cork). A blend of 80% Cabernet Sauvignon and 20% Merlot, it is a powerful, tannic, blockbuster effort revealing a liqueur of mineral-like component intermixed with creme de cassis, raspberry, and flower…

Robert Parker (RP) — 94–96/100 · Wine Advocate, RobertParker.com, 30/04/2005 · Drink 2010-2025

This is one of the finest Ducru Beaucaillous made in the last 20 to 25 years. Certainly in the spirit of the 1982, the wine is atypically opulent and viscous, but still carries its trademark St.-Julien elegance. Deep ruby/purple in color with a sweet nose of jammy cassis intermixed with flowers and some of the tell-tale wet stone/minerality of this estate on display, it is viscous, voluptuously t…

Robert Parker (RP) — 93–95/100 · Wine Advocate, RobertParker.com, 30/04/2004 · Drink 2004-2029

The first vintage managed from start to finish by Bruno Borie, who replaced his younger brother, Xavier, at Ducru Beaucaillou, the 2003 is an atypically plump, juicy, fat, fleshy effort that does a terrific job of hiding its 13% alcohol.
